Data Engineer / Developer

V-Soft Consulting Group, Inc. - Durham, NC3.5

Primary Location – Durham, North Carolina

V-Soft Consulting is an end-to-end recruiting and staffing solution provider known for our ability to provide highly qualified consultants for any project at any scale.

What makes us different? Our expertise is derived from over 20 years of delivering world-class IT staffing, consulting, engineering and managed services to Fortune 1000 and mid-market companies in the U.S., Canada, and Asia. V-Soft is a trusted partner with experience across diverse technology stacks to help business get IT done.

Like what you hear? Apply with V-Soft today!

V-Soft Consulting is currently hiring for a Data Engineer / Developer for our premier client in Durham, North Carolina. This is a 6+ month contract position in the financial services industry.

Education and Experience »

A Bachelor’s Degree or demonstrated analytical and technical abilities
8+ years of experience in one or more of the following disciplines: data engineering, Python development, software engineering or database development
Experience working with analytics stakeholders to understand and propose solutions and approaches to sophisticated analytical problems
Experience developing and maintaining Linux-based applications, including basic Linux commands and bash scripting
Experience building and maintaining REST APIs built in Python
Experience working in Agile/Scrum methodologies
Experience working for a financial organization
Experience with large-scale data sets (50+ terabytes, 1+ petabyte) is a plus
Exposure to Relational and NoSQL Databases and ETL tools is a plus
Experience with Java and/or other object-oriented languages is a plus
Exposure to ELK stack is a plus

Knowledge, Skills and Abilities »

Deep understanding how data supports business strategy, and how it is used within business processes and its impact
Working understanding of SCM, build, static analysis, automated testing and deployment
Solid understanding of SDLC around CI/CD
Strong technical security experience with sensitive and critical data elements
Strong communication skills across both business and technical communities
Strong analytical, diagnostic and problem-solving skills
Proficiency in SQL and Object Orientation Languages (such as Java)
Passion for data and how data is used to drive enterprise business strategy
Self-directed and able to proactively manage complex projects unsupervised
Basic project management skills
Results-oriented with the ability to clearly articulate and deliver business value
Ability to build trust and strong working relationships with cross-functional teams
Ability to balance team and individual responsibilities

Job Responsibilities »

Design, develop and deploy scalable solutions based on Python and running on Linux platforms
Update and create standards around data ingestion and processes within the analytics ecosystem for scalable and maintainable platforms
Identify currently inefficient processes and data flows, and propose future state, focusing on data quality and performance


Qualified candidates should send their resumes to

V-Soft Consulting Group is headquartered in Louisville, KY with strategic locations in India and across the U.S., including Madison, Chicago, Denver, Harrisburg and Atlanta. Known as an agile innovative technology services company, we were recently rewarded the Large Business of the Year award from Louisville Business First, and were recognized among the top 100 fastest growing staffing companies in North America. V-Soft has a wide variety of partnerships across diverse technology stacks, and holds such titles as MuleSoft Certified Delivery Resource, Oracle Gold Partner, ServiceNow Partner, Microsoft Partner and Cisco Registered Partner, amongst many others.

For more information or to view all our open jobs, please visit or call (844) 425-8425.